Keyless Entry System Programming

Certain cars have key fobs that need programming to work. These key fobs contain a chip that communicates with the onboard computer of the car. This system is designed to prevent the entry of unauthorized persons by having to verify that the key fob's code matches a specific code in the car's database. Without the correct code the key won't turn and will not start the vehicle. To program these keys, a locksmith uses special tools and software.

If you are able to do it some older cars allow you to program your key fobs. The owner's manual will typically describe the procedure. However, for vehicles with more modern technology, it is recommended to speak with an expert NYC locksmith for the steps needed to program the remote key fob.

Most professional key programmers will have a database of codes for different models and years of vehicles. There are a number of additional features that can be programmed into the fob, along with these codes. Some allow you to program a second car key or erase a stolen one from the system.



In newer vehicles the button is typically located on the key fob. It must be pressed in a certain sequence to enter programming mode. Typically, the first step is to insert and take out the key from the ignition, without turning on the vehicle. Then, you press a series buttons within a specified time period.  autolocksmith  could be as simple as pressing the 'lock' or 'unlock buttons several times or it may involve press and hold two numbers. In most cases, a chime will sound or the door locks will be able to cycle to indicate that the car is currently in programming mode.

Certain key fobs can be programmed using a special device that connects to the OBD port located under the steering wheel. Locksmiths or dealership service departments could do this. This tool is able to read codes from keys, and then match them with a code stored in the database. This is an extremely efficient method to program a key or reset one that has been lost.

Transponder Programming is a nitty-gritty process that involves creating a unique code for every key. This unique code is what the key transmits when it is put into the ignition. The car's system will check this code against the one stored in its own system. If the codes are the same, the car will start. This is a fantastic security feature that will prevent theft. It's something to look into if you wish to add a layer of protection to your vehicle.

Certain vehicles give their owners the ability to reprogramme their transponder keys on their own under certain conditions. The vehicle must be a domestic model and have a VIN that starts with either 1 or 4. Regardless the case, reprogramming a transponder device isn't an easy job and it should be left to experts.
